High above the bustling streets of Bangkok stands the Embassy of Israel. A beacon of diplomacy in the heart of Thailand. This isn’t just any building. It’s a symbol of a strong relationship. A relationship forged over decades of cooperation.

The Embassy of Israel opened its doors in 1958. It quickly became a vital link between two distant yet connected nations. Here Israeli diplomats work tirelessly. They foster understanding and cooperation. They navigate complex political landscapes. They protect Israeli interests in Thailand.

But this building holds more than just diplomatic significance. It has witnessed history unfold. In 1972 the Embassy was the scene of a dramatic hostage crisis. Black September terrorists seized the ambassador and guests. The Thai government responded swiftly and skillfully. They negotiated a peaceful resolution. The hostages were freed unharmed. This event stands as a testament to Thailand’s diplomatic prowess.

Today the Embassy of Israel in Bangkok offers a wide array of services. It issues and renews passports. It provides consular assistance. It processes visa applications for Israelis. For those living or traveling here it is a vital resource.

The Embassy isn’t isolated. It actively participates in the community. It fosters cultural exchanges. It promotes Israeli innovation and technology. It strengthens the bonds between Israel and Thailand.
